Scholarships for Underrepresented Student Groups
In an effort to foster diversity in higher education, scholarship funding is now available for students from underrepresented backgrounds. This program specifically targets students who come from low-income families or face societal challenges that threaten their educational pursuits. This funding serves to alleviate financial burdens that can deter capable students from seeking higher education and contributes to a more equitable admissions landscape.
Contemporary examples of success within this initiative include a student who, despite facing systemic barriers, successfully secured funding to attend a prestigious university, ultimately emerging as a leader within their chosen field. In another case, a student exhibiting resilience through community service and leadership roles was provided the financial assistance needed to achieve their academic goals, thus enhancing representation in the university setting.
To qualify for this funding, applicants must demonstrate not only financial need but also a commitment to personal development and community engagement. The program aims to uplift students who showcase initiative and leadership, encouraging them to pursue educational opportunities. However, applicants who lack a demonstrated commitment to their community or do not engage in impactful activities may find themselves ineligible for funding.
With increasing attention on equity in education, this funding aligns with shifting policies aimed at granting access to marginalized student populations. Recent reports indicate a need for academic institutions to diversify their recruitment efforts, recognizing that the vibrant cultures and perspectives represented by diverse student bodies enhance the educational experience for all. By investing in the educational journeys of underrepresented students, institutions can cultivate a more inclusive environment.
Educational Enrichment and Diversity Goals
The expected outcomes of this funding are multi-faceted, focusing on both improving enrollment and retention rates among challenged students while also enhancing campus diversity. Institutions are encouraged to measure success through specific metrics, such as the percentage of funded students who persist in their studies beyond the first year, the proportion who graduate within a prescribed timeframe, and the impact of enriched diversity on campus life and learning outcomes.
In terms of accountability, participating institutions will need to establish transparent reporting mechanisms, detailing how funding is utilized and the resultant outcomes for enrolled students. Evaluation will center on not only quantitative metrics but also qualitative assessments, like student satisfaction and engagement levels, to provide a holistic view of the program’s impact.
In conclusion, this scholarship initiative underscores a commitment to promoting diversity and equity in educational settings, contributing significantly to the development of future leaders who bring varied experiences and perspectives to their fields.
